Suspect says he killed Dubuque woman because there “was nothing better to do”

DUBUQUE, Iowa (KWWL) – A Dubuque man said he sexually assaulted and killed a random woman Tuesday because there “was nothing better to do,” and says the victim was in the “wrong place at the wrong time,” according to the criminal complaint obtained by NBC affiliate, KWWL Wednesday. Police say a woman was found lying on the ground in the 100 block of West 17th St. early Tuesday morning with severe facial injuries. She was taken to Finley Hospital in Dubuque where she would later die of her injuries. Documents indicate there no weapons involved, and that she most likely was beaten to death. On Thursday, police identified the victim as 66 year old Nancy Ann Krapfl of Dubuque.

According to a press release from police, Helmon Betwell, 19, was arrested Tuesday night and charged with first-degree murder, first-degree sexual assault and two counts of third-degree burglary.

Betwell made his initial appearance in court this morning via video from the Dubuque County Jail. His bond is set at $1 million cash.
